How to Make No Bake Coconut Cream Pie Recipe Step by Step

no bake coconut cream pie recipe
  1. In a mixing bowl, combine 1 cup of sweetened shredded coconut, 1 cup of heavy cream, and 1 cup of sweetened condensed milk.
  2. Whisk the mixture until it’s smooth and well combined.
  3. Add 1 teaspoon of vanilla extract and mix again.
  4. In a separate bowl, whip another cup of heavy cream until stiff peaks form.
  5. Gently fold the whipped cream into the coconut mixture until fully incorporated.
  6. Pour the filling into a prepared graham cracker crust.
  7. Spread the filling evenly and smooth the top with a spatula.
  8. Chill the pie in the refrigerator for at least 4 hours, or until set.
  9. Before serving, top with additional whipped cream and sprinkle extra shredded coconut on top for garnish.
  10. Slice and enjoy your no bake coconut cream pie!

Troubleshooting: Common Mistakes to Avoid

  • Issue: Difficulty in achieving the right texture — Fix: For a smooth finish in your easy no bake coconut pie, ensure you use full-fat coconut milk and blend until creamy.
  • Issue: Crust not holding together — Fix: To make your graham cracker coconut pie crust more cohesive, mix in melted butter and press firmly into the pan before chilling.
  • Issue: Filling too runny — Fix: For a firmer coconut cream pie recipe, add a little cornstarch to the coconut pudding pie mixture and allow it to set in the fridge longer.
  • Issue: Lack of coconut flavor — Fix: Enhance your no bake coconut dessert by incorporating shredded coconut into the filling and topping for added texture and taste.
